advisedWhat do you know about Emirates Airlines and its values?

What Do You Know About Emirates Airlines And Its Values?

English

Advice: Discuss its establishment in 1985, extensive global network of over 150 destinations, diverse workforce, and core values of innovation, excellence, and customer focus.

advisedWhat do you know about Emirates?

What do you know about Emirates?

English

Advice: Mention that it is one of the world's largest international airlines based in Dubai, recognized for safety, premium service, and modern aircraft.

Common questions

What questions does Emirates Group ask?

Reported interview questions in this corpus most often cover teamwork scenarios and customer service. The exact interview can vary by role and location.

What languages are covered for Emirates Group?

The corpus includes English (11 videos) and Arabic (1 video).

What salary is mentioned for Emirates Group?

The corpus mentions AED 4,000 - 7,000 per month (Full-time); AED 3,000 - 4,500 per month (Part-time) and Tax-free salary paid in Dirhams (AED). These figures are self-reported in videos and not verified.
